4. How to Find the LCM of 494 and 495?

Answer:

Least Common Multiple of 494 and 495 = 244530

Step 1: Find the prime factorization of 494

494 = 2 x 13 x 19

Step 2: Find the prime factorization of 495

495 = 3 x 3 x 5 x 11

Step 3: Multiply each factor the greater number of times it occurs in steps i) or ii) above to find the lcm:

LCM = 244530 = 2 x 3 x 3 x 5 x 11 x 13 x 19

Step 4: Therefore, the least common multiple of 494 and 495 is 244530.
